No inhibitor or cleanser. Pipes in the same order (west of scotland is vokera land so probably same everything, lift off on) at most half a dozen elbows and unions (£3) a couple of cuttings of pipe out the scrap bag (0.5kg ..£2). 3m of 3/4" overflow, 4 elbows an inch and half tee and a reducer to 3/4" ...£6 so £11 -15 tops for materials
Band B Vokera (still sold and legal up here) £510 leaves £265 minus 20% = £212.
Not a lot but beats sitting in the house watching Jeremy Kyle!

I don't agree with the pricing but if you are a one man band forced into working for yourself because there are no jobs about, then the money is better than what you are used to. Customer service will be bad to non existent.
People get what they pay for and the service and quality of work to suit but there are a helluva lot of people counting the coppers these days.

The good times are over for heating and they will never come back regardless of BG and the like still charging £3k for the same thing.
Most people know they are getting ripped off from them but they still choose to go there because they will always answer the phone and be there straight away if anything goes wrong.
The independent guy has to be very good and well recommended to get in with a shout with a decent price or be signed up as a credit broker :wink:
